And with other animals, too. I had a German shepherd who was chill about me being around his food but never had another dog around him while he was eating.

At some point while he was still younger than 2 we had a family get together. Brother brought his dog over. Sweetest pit you'd ever meet.

Time to feed the dogs. Had them separated, but she finished before my dog and she came sniffing around. He didn't like that and nipped at her. She backed off, but the flags were raised.

With my brothers reluctant permission, I had to give him some on the spot training. I had to sit there between the dogs while he ate, petting my brother's dog and mine while slowly moving her closer so he had a chance to get used to it with someone he trusts guiding the whole thing along.

In the end he was fine and never had anymore issues with dogs being around him, but I kept a watchful eye on him after that any time another dog was around.
